Transaction 50bee4ba5e8a407dbb05168e71446c83454cd355b563de18d0926ad523effb7c

block
6e21dff0e1c1c8d477d2bcba4189a48a6dcbd70ab0760bed569cd672b9f50809

9 Inputs

8 Outputs